On the July 4th holiday weekend, CBS News aired a special edition of Face the Nation with Margaret Brennan, featuring Representatives Adriano Espaillat and Carlos Gimenez in conversation with correspondent Ed O'Keefe. The two congressmen represent notably different political perspectives, with Espaillat a Democrat from New York and Gimenez a Republican from Florida, suggesting the program took up some issue where both sides were invited to weigh in.
